Area of research
Electrical and Electronic Engineering · Materials Chemistry
Research interest
Research focused on Cathode and Anode, with related work in Electrochemistry, Nanosheet, Vanadium. Notable publications include 'Principles of interlayer-spacing regulation of layered vanadium phosphates for superior zinc-ion batteries', 'Single‐Atom or Dual‐Atom in TiO 2 Nanosheet: Which is the Better Choice for Electrocatalytic Urea Synthesis?', and 'Bilayered VOPO 4 ⋅2H 2 O Nanosheets with High‐Concentration Oxygen Vacancies for High‐Performance Aqueous Zinc‐Ion Batteries'.
